Protecting Energy Flows During Remodeling

Renovating or remodeling a home changes its spatial energy field. When you remove a wall, build an extension, or join two flats, you alter the layout of the 16 Vastu zones. If this process is not planned carefully, it can trigger sudden energy imbalances, leading to career delays, financial stress, or relationship challenges during or after the project.

We focus on protecting energy flows. We map the property’s zones before any work starts. When removing walls, we use metal correctors to support load-bearing energies. For flat merges, we balance the center (Brahmasthan) and entrances to create a single, unified energy field, avoiding structural disruption.
